Transaction 96a76a5542d91a02f682ae5062dc23b08d79589f10f8bae26c13d7c984c96987
1 Input
1 Output
-
96a76a5542d91a02f682ae5062dc23b08d79589f10f8bae26c13d7c984c96987:0
- value
- 8436419
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9de6b4b0c43e1406ef20ba48c7a0915051210d90 OP_EQUAL
- address
- 3G5vPP9awV9bGDWTZ7H1Vmwx7R8coG4DcC